Latest Patents

Bum-Su Park holds a patent for "Aptamer sandwich assays." This invention provides methods for identifying a plurality of aptamers that bind to different sites of a target molecule. The methods can be utilized in sandwich assays, enhancing the specificity and sensitivity of detection. The aptamers are identified from a library generated through the SELEX process, showcasing a novel approach to molecular recognition.
